  • Cardamoms & Rose is a South Asian-rooted mental health and community space dedicated to wellbeing through connection, culture, and care. Inspired by two prominent notes across South Asian culture; cardamoms and rose, the space was created to offer healing that feels familiar, grounded, and welcoming.

    We offer therapy, workshops, and community gatherings where conversations about mental health can exist alongside culture, family, identity, and belonging. Our goal is to create spaces where people feel seen and supported; whether through individual therapy, reflective workshops, or shared community experiences.

  • These two distinct aromas are something that are deeply ingrained in many parts of South Asian culture. Weather it is infused within the drinks we share, meals that are prepared or everything else in between, the name offers a chance to celebrate the community rituals that are intertwined with these notes.

  • Cardamoms & Rose was founded by Maham and Muneeb. Maham is a facilitator with experience in wellbeing economy spaces and community-centered initiatives. Her work focuses on creating spaces for reflection, dialogue, and collective healing, bringing a community care perspective to mental wellbeing.

    Muneeb is a registered Psychotherapist who offers culturally responsive therapy for individuals navigating anxiety, identity, relationships, and life transitions. His work supports people in exploring their mental health in ways that honor their cultural experiences and personal stories.

    Together, they created Cardamoms & Rose as a space where clinical care and community healing can exist side by side; where therapy, conversation, and cultural connection come together to support wellbeing.
